Obverse description The obverse depicts a coat of arms surmounted by a helmeted figure, likely representing Heinrich von Galen, Master of the Livonian Order, in relief at the center of the field. A circular legend surrounds the device, bordered by a beaded rim.
Obverse script Log in to see details
Obverse lettering HENRICVS . DE GALEN . D. M. LIVONIE 1557
Reverse description The reverse features the city arms of Riga — a gateway flanked by two towers beneath a cross and an eagle displayed — rendered in relief at the center of the field. The circular legend reading MONETA NOVA RIGENSIS surrounds the device, enclosed by a beaded rim.
